We have a specific requirement in IDOC to file scenario. We initially implemented to trigger IDOC and place in FTP folder based upon the country code. Used variable substitution.

Now, we have received a new requirement on the same interface. For a specific country, we need to generate two files, one with price and second without price.

Solution, we thought of is to create a dummy folder and place the file, and create a new interface to pick up the file and archive and while processing it generates the second file. But, client did not want to create a new interface.

Is there any other possibility achieve the requirement ? Please suggest.

As per my understanding you can have another set of 

Service Interface and Message Mapping and Operation Mapping and you can map the root field creation based on country code for the new Mapping.

Basically it means if you have certain code only one message mapping should run and in case of certain code both the mappings should run.

Now in configuration(ID) you can have two interface determination and two receiver agreement and respective channels with different paths.
